Let’s Talk Power: It’s All About the Punch
The core of this lamp is its serious power density. We’re talking 2500W of heat packed into a 400V system. That’s a lot of energy, and it’s all squeezed into a compact 300mm tube. The size isn’t an accident. At 300mm long and just 11mm in diameter, it’s built to slide right into the standard machine cavities you already have. No modifications needed. That 2500W punch means the target surface hits operating temperature almost instantly. But, with that kind of power comes responsibility. This kind of heat puts a lot of stress on the lamp itself and everything around it. So, you need to make sure your machine’s cooling and thermal management systems are up to the task. They’re going to feel the ambient heat, so they have to be ready for it.
What’s Inside: The Secret to Clean, Consistent Heat
The magic happens inside the quartz glass tube. It’s filled with halogen gas, and that’s what keeps the filament from blackening over time. The payoff? A long, consistent life with steady heat and light output, far outlasting a standard incandescent bulb. The “White” in the name comes from a special coating on the quartz. This coating filters out the shorter wavelengths, shifting the output toward the near and medium infrared spectrum. The result is a cleaner, more controllable heat that’s less likely to scorch or discolor sensitive materials. And the R7S bi-pin connector? That’s the industry standard for a reason. It gives you a secure, two-point connection that can handle the high current without getting hot itself. Plus, it makes installation a simple drop-in job.
The Real-World Win: Heat Where You Need It, When You Need It
On the factory floor, this lamp solves a specific, frustrating problem: getting maximum heat into a space where there’s barely any room to work. Its 300mm length and R7S base mean it fits perfectly into the heating zones of blow molding heads or sealing bars. The focused infrared output heats the material directly, not the air around it. That direct energy transfer is a huge win for efficiency and helps you cut down on cycle times. This lamp is built tough for the factory floor, but it runs hot. So, you have to treat it right. Always double-check that your socket and wiring are rated for the lamp’s voltage and wattage.
